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Aviator Game
At its heart, the aviator game is incredibly straightforward. A plane takes off on the screen, and as it ascends, a multiplier increases. Players place bets before each round, and the goal is to cash out before the plane disappears from view. The long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ier, and therefore, the larger the potential payout. However, the plane can crash at any moment, resulting in a loss of the bet. This element of unpredictability is what makes the game so captivating and addictive.

Understanding Volatility and its Impact on Gameplay
Volatility, also known as variance, is a critical concept in understanding the risk associated with the aviator game. High volatility means that wins are less frequent but potentially larger, while low volatility means that wins are more frequent but smaller. The aviator game generally has a high degree of volatility, meaning that players can experience long losing streaks punctuated by occasional substantial wins. This makes it crucial to manage your bankroll effectively and be prepared for potential fluctuations. Players should be aware that there’s no sure way of knowing when a large payout will occur; it’s a matter of chance. Therefore, it’s important to set realistic expectations and avoid betting more than you can afford to lose. Understanding the relationship between volatility and risk is key to developing a responsible and effective playing strategy.
